Output 81a54ae9430387b76f01ca6e791675291c4af070b8f27886ff54057e132c3027:2

value
2937497
script pubkey
OP_0 OP_PUSHBYTES_20 26f0c934281e9bcd972de0032e80cebba254c593
address
bc1qymcvjdpgr6dum9eduqpjaqxwhw39f3vncmmddh
transaction
81a54ae9430387b76f01ca6e791675291c4af070b8f27886ff54057e132c3027
spent
false